Abstract

A fifteen year old male with post renal failure secondary to urolithiasis is reported. The patient presented with recurrent UTI difficulty urinating, flank pain and dysuria. Laboratory results revealed microscopic hematuria and anemia KUB UTZ, giving the diagnosis of urolithiasis. Upon admission, patient had impaired renal function. Open cystolithotomy was done which gradually improved the renal function.
